Queens Terrace is in Sherborne and in West Dorset district. DT9 4ED is located in the Sherborne East elect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of West Dorset.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ding DT9 4ED,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.1%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Queens Terrace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Queens Terrace was 108.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 69.9% higher than the Sherborne East average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Queens Terrace has the 5th highest crime rate of 32 local areas in Sherborne East and the 159th highest crime rate of 1,293 local areas in Dorset .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 59.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 3.4%.

Employment

DT9 4ED area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 3%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in DT9 4ED area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 33%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
